Comparison of Blood Pressure Variability between 24 h Ambulatory Monitoring and Office Blood Pressure in Diabetics and Nondiabetic Patients: A Cross-Sectional Study.

Ana Lídia Rouxinol-DiasMarta Lisandra GonçalvesDiogo RamalhoJose SilvaLoide BarbosaJorge Junqueira Polónia
Published in: International journal of hypertension (2022)
We found that diabetes is associated with higher variability of daytime BP than nondiabetics along with worse damage of vascular and renal function. However, in contrast to nondiabetics, in diabetics eGFR and PWV may not be dependent on BP variability, suggesting that other mechanisms might explain more rigorously the greater damage of target organ lesion markers.
